                I liked Romney's tax plan the way it was described last night. It seemed different than I'd heard it before.

                He basically indicated that above 200k income, deductions such as mortgage interest would become unavailable. Those people under that amount can pick and choose from the already existing deductions however they want as long as those deductions don't exceed 25k which seems perfectly generous. And lower rates across the board if I'm not mistaken. Plus a zero percent capital gains rate for those under 200k.

                Was I hearing that right? And is this what it's always been?
